Runbook fragment — Haulmark fuel-usage report. When reviewing changes to the nightly aggregation, verify the odometer-delta join still excludes vehicles flagged as decommissioned; including them inflates fleet totals by several percent. Run the fixture suite against the Bramford depot sample and compare against the golden output. Before approving, confirm the report header embeds the build token shown below.

session token of bawep-yadup = htk21_528abd376e3c5a4ec24a1

# Break-Glass: Catalog Cache Invalidation

Scope: the Pinrow product catalog at Veldstone Retail. If stale prices persist after a purge and the Hollowmere invalidation queue is wedged, use break-glass to flush the edge tier directly. Contractors: get verbal sign-off from the catalog lead first. Steps: open the Hollowmere admin shell, select emergency-flush, confirm the tenant, and run it once — repeated flushes thrash the origin. Access is logged and expires after 20 minutes. Unseal the admin shell with the passphrase below.

recovery phrase for kahop-tajog: istix-casvan

Design excerpt — Tallyfern loyalty ledger. The ledger treats every points mutation as an append-only entry; balances are materialized views rebuilt from checkpoints. Reviewer, note that compaction frequency and checkpoint spacing trade replay cost against write amplification, and both interact with the expiry sweep that voids stale points. Getting these wrong either bloats storage or makes recovery after a crash unacceptably slow. The proposed constants, validated in the Hollowmere staging run, follow.

constants for tageg-kagag:
QUOTAS = {
    "kelax": 495,
    "istath": 366,
    "tammir": 108,
    "novdor": 730,
    "casax": 816,
    "quenael": 874,
    "pelius": 403,
}